Is Norwich worth visiting?
As well as being the most complete medieval city in the UK with stunning Norman Cathedral and Castle, it has a flourishing arts, music and cultural scene, superb independent as well as High Street shopping, quaint covered market, lively restaurants, bars and nightlife and a heritage that is a delight to explore.

How do I spend a day in Norwich?
Wander around the Norwich Castle Museum & Art Gallery or horticultural gem Bishop’s House Garden before hopping on a rented bike. Pedal up to Mousehold Heath for great views of Norwich cathedral and castle. Wend your way alongside the River Wensum, pausing at ancient Cow Tower.

How many people live in Norwich?
Table 1 – Population of the largest settlements in Greater Norwich, 2011
| Settlement | Population 2011 census9 |
|---|---|
| Norwich urban area | 213,166 |
| Wymondham | 14,405 |
| Diss | 7,572 |
| Aylsham | 6,016 |
